Share Share on Facebook Share on Twitter Pinterest Email New data suggest that, despite hurdles, inflation is still on track toward the 2-percent level. 0 Related Posts To Whip Inflation, Trump Needs The Courage To Be Unpopular January 30, 2025 In Memory of Richard M. Doncaster January 29, 2025 Against Central Bank Independence January 29, 2025